Tideline Widget v3 is maintained by the Saltmere Tools group. Releases cut from `main` every second Tuesday. Known issues: harmonic constants for the Fenwick Estuary stations are stale; fix lands in 3.2. Do not hotfix tide math without sign-off from the oceanography reviewers. Build failures on the ARM runners are tracked separately — check the pipeline dashboard before filing. For release blockers, regressions in predicted tide heights, or anything affecting the Pellbrook ferry integration, contact the maintainers at the address below.

escalation mailbox, yajeg-bageg: quenax.olidor@lumiccorp.internal

Two custodians must be present; verify both against the custodian roster before proceeding. Generate the keypair on the air-gapped laptop, confirm the fingerprint aloud, and record it in the ceremony log. Seal the hardware token in the tamper-evident bag. Before sealing, the token must be initialized with the recovery passphrase written directly below.

recovery phrase for tawef-bawef: ralath-jorius-casok-julok

**Alert: EXIF scrub failures on PixelBarn uploads**

Hey newcomers! This alert fires when the Scrubbly worker fails to strip EXIF metadata from user-uploaded images before they hit the public CDN. It's a privacy thing — GPS coordinates and camera serials must never leak. Usually it's a malformed JPEG or a timeout in the metadata parser. Don't silence it; escalate if the failure count climbs past ten per hour. Full triage steps are on the internal page here.

wiki page, tahaf-tajog: https://jira.ordindyn.corp/pipeline

Capacity note for the Bramblewick export retry queue. Failed exports are requeued with exponential backoff, and the queue depth is our main capacity signal: sustained depth above the high-water mark means downstream Pellis storage is saturated, not that we need more workers. As the new contractor, please don't raise worker counts without checking storage latency first — it usually makes things worse. Retry timing, backoff caps, and the high-water threshold are all driven by the constants shown below.

limits module of yagef-bajog:
TIERS = {
    "druael": 370,
    "tamix": 286,
    "pelius": 541,
    "pelael": 78,
    "pelox": 47,
    "ralath": 533,
    "drumir": 801,
}